"We're trying to validate and recognize the central role coding plays in today's hospital-from both a financial perspective and a patient-care perspective," says Dean Farley, PhD, vice president of healthcare policy and analysis for HSS, Inc., in Camden, CT. The healthcare research and consulting firm released the results of its national study on inpatient coding performance in the published report Top 200 Coding Hospitals in the U.S.
